When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Gayle?
The weather is important when you're experiencing new places, so here's some information that might be helpful: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 55°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 38°F. Average annual precipitation for Gayle is 53 inches.
What is there to see and do in Gayle?
In general, Gayle is known for its bars, monuments, and restaurants. Major attractions include Yorkshire Dales National Park. Get out into nature with places like Hardraw Force, Wensleydale, and Aysgarth Falls. Cultural attractions include The Forbidden Corner, Swaledale Museum, and Dales Countryside Museum.
